    A Letter To Players Of Slots Oasis Casino

    I just wanted to say a few things about Slots Oasis and the way i feel the customers are being treated as far as payments and the reason why?

    Why you ask? There are some pretty peeved off customers who have waited for so long on the money they have won, i myself had a great run starting last week at both Slots and Rushmore, heres how it went down.

    I had a cashout of 300.00, was excited, p.m'ed Louise, had a reply back that she would be sending it over to the accounts mgr. so that he could take care of this for me, well waited a bit and decided to play some more, so i reversed it, got it up to 2k, cashed out, did the same thing at Rushmore, boom!!! another 2k cashed out.


    I made many calls and was on chat several times, with both casinos, i wanted to know what was going on with my withdrawals, got the same as everyone else, Louise is on vacation, she will be back on Tuesday, then Louise will be back on Sunday and now i guess Louise will be back Wed. so Louise has said.

    I did get ahold of a customer service rep, who unlike the others gave me the skinny as to whats going on, first of all he feels bad that there is nothing he can do about it as far as getting folks paid as there is a problem with back logged withdrawals and upper management, its not the C/S reps fault.

    When i found out it could be next week or much later that i would get paid, i played the hell out of it, of course the house won, this time, cant win everytime.

    I feel that Louise, and i do like Louise alot, but is she being honest with us here at Casinomeister, as a casino rep. and friend to the player or is she now in the role of upper management, not being forth coming about what really is going on, i want to think her hands are tied, we have heard a couple of reasons why, wasn't this an issue awhile back?

    I saw those red flags you talked about Nashvegas and i will not be playing at these casinos anymore till i know that these issues with payments have been resolved. This is nothing personal against Louise or the customer service staff at all but the ones above them, such as the so called V.I.P department and upper management.

    Rant over!!!!!!!!!

    In my opinion we should not to have to rely on Louise to get our payments processed, she is one person. The whole Rushmore group should be addressed because it should not take one person to "Make it Happen
    This is a very important point.

    The Rushmore group has stated (and told Bryan I believe) that there has been 'processor issues' which have caused the delays in payments.

    Yet, when a player contacts Louise, she can have it paid almost immediately.

    So where is the processing problem? If Louise can pay someone instantly, why cant every other player be paid within 24-48 hours?

    If the wheels stop turning when Louise isnt there, then either the staff need replacing or they need to employ someone else who can do what she does.

    Mind you, the only advantage of having Louise there is that CM members are able to get priority, which, while its great for us, isnt fair to other players.
